On June 4 in SVR history.
- 1941 RAF Bridgnorth was designated a WAAF training centre, until the following year
- 1978: Sunday of the 'Great Western Weekend' gala, celebrating the 100th anniversary of the opening of the Kidderminster Loop Line.[1]
- 1988 SR 34027 was formally renamed Taw Valley following restoration[2].
- 2022: Saturday of a 4-day special event to mark the Queen's Platinum Jubilee, featuring No 70 Elizabeth II and guest 2999 Lady of Legend.
